summaryrefslogtreecommitdiff
path: root/nuttx/examples/nsh/nsh_telnetd.c
diff options
context:
space:
mode:
authorpatacongo <patacongo@42af7a65-404d-4744-a932-0658087f49c3>2008-08-14 23:37:12 +0000
committerpatacongo <patacongo@42af7a65-404d-4744-a932-0658087f49c3>2008-08-14 23:37:12 +0000
commit24738c1122691d74a8a3b7713c2878d5ed32486c (patch)
tree95474c328e4af9e7a046267ac03eaa3eeceb144f /nuttx/examples/nsh/nsh_telnetd.c
parent3169482b6c251e6c532b96c7af5ce2b181660706 (diff)
downloadpx4-nuttx-24738c1122691d74a8a3b7713c2878d5ed32486c.tar.gz
px4-nuttx-24738c1122691d74a8a3b7713c2878d5ed32486c.tar.bz2
px4-nuttx-24738c1122691d74a8a3b7713c2878d5ed32486c.zip
Fix reentrancy problems for serial
git-svn-id: svn://svn.code.sf.net/p/nuttx/code/trunk@821 42af7a65-404d-4744-a932-0658087f49c3
Diffstat (limited to 'nuttx/examples/nsh/nsh_telnetd.c')
-rw-r--r--nuttx/examples/nsh/nsh_telnetd.c10
1 files changed, 5 insertions, 5 deletions
diff --git a/nuttx/examples/nsh/nsh_telnetd.c b/nuttx/examples/nsh/nsh_telnetd.c
index 0dbf6b18b..3f1c1374d 100644
--- a/nuttx/examples/nsh/nsh_telnetd.c
+++ b/nuttx/examples/nsh/nsh_telnetd.c
@@ -401,7 +401,7 @@ static void *nsh_connection(void *arg)
****************************************************************************/
/****************************************************************************
- * Name: nsh_telnetmain
+ * Name: nsh_main
*
* Description:
* This is the main processing thread for telnetd. It never returns
@@ -409,7 +409,7 @@ static void *nsh_connection(void *arg)
*
****************************************************************************/
-int nsh_telnetmain(void)
+int nsh_main(void)
{
struct in_addr addr;
#if defined(CONFIG_EXAMPLES_NSH_DHCPC) || defined(CONFIG_EXAMPLES_NSH_NOMAC)
@@ -492,7 +492,7 @@ int nsh_telnetmain(void)
}
/****************************************************************************
- * Name: nsh_telnetout
+ * Name: nsh_output
*
* Description:
* Print a string to the remote shell window.
@@ -503,7 +503,7 @@ int nsh_telnetmain(void)
*
****************************************************************************/
-int nsh_telnetout(FAR void *handle, const char *fmt, ...)
+int nsh_output(FAR void *handle, const char *fmt, ...)
{
struct telnetd_s *pstate = (struct telnetd_s *)handle;
int nbytes = pstate->tn_sndlen;
@@ -558,7 +558,7 @@ int nsh_telnetout(FAR void *handle, const char *fmt, ...)
*
****************************************************************************/
-extern char *nsh_linebuffer(FAR void *handle)
+FAR char *nsh_linebuffer(FAR void *handle)
{
struct telnetd_s *pstate = (struct telnetd_s *)handle;
return pstate->tn_cmd;